  6. So here is my recent Pontiac History: It all started with my dad's 02 SLE, which was a company car at the time. He had it from about 2006 till May 2009. Maroon, had the L36 N/A 3800, leather, pretty much fully loaded for an SLE, aside from some power adjustments on the seats. I only have one pic: I first had a 98 Tahoe, but was never really happy with it. I started looking around on CL, etc and found a Black '00 Bonne SSEi. Every option but a CD Changer and heated seats. I bought it Memorial Day weekend 2008. Pics: I absolutely loved the car. It had everything I wanted (except heated seats), got much better mileage than my Tahoe, ran like a scalded ape and fit my 6'6" build. Unfortunately, less than 2 months later, it met its demise to the back of a pea-hauling dump truck. I was luckily OK, but the car was totalled. The car got sold through my insurance to a member on Pontiac Bonneville Club, the site I found when I was searching for problems and a forum for these cars. I've been an active member on there ever since. He parted it out and made a good profit on it. The deal with buying my 00 was that I had to sell the Tahoe (didn't sell in the time I had the 00), so I was back to driving the Tahoe till it Sold, which wasn't till October. 4 days later I drove home in this: My current car, a 2003 SSEi. It had 139k on it when I bought it (got a good deal on it for the year, last of the SSEi). It has everything but heated seats ; Including: XM, 12 disc CD changer, full power seats, memory driver's setting, HUD, etc. First thing the car got was new tires, GY Triple Treds (worst tires ever after 20k, FWIW). A few months later I did some mods, including an Intense Racing Fenderwell Intake (tubing leads to filter in bumper) along with a smaller S/C pulley and colder thermostat. I also replaced the Lower Intake Manifold Gaskets, as they're a common failure on these cars. I also wrinkle coated the S/C and valvecovers, for some heat-shedding due to surface area, mostly for the aesthetics. Pics: I've done a bunch of mods since then. My mom backed into it, so I got a new front bumper, hood and headlights from our Insurance. For performance, I've gotten a tune, added a 3" exhaust downpipe and 3" high-flow cat, and gone down to a 3.6" pulley due to knock. I have more mods planned, that will go in another thread. More random pics: And now the newest addition, the 2005 Bonne GXP. When dad's company switched from company owned cars to giving employees a car allowance, they liquidated a bunch of their cars. It was either buy the 02 SLE or buy this GXP, and dad decided he wanted something nice, so he got the GXP. It's an 05, has EVERY option, XM, heated seats, HUD, CDX, Northstar V8, 18" wheels, 13" front brakes, etc. It's been a great car. He bought it with 46k, now has almost 90k. We got it in May 2009, my prom weekend, LOL. The only thing that's been done to it is maintenance, new tires (went with Kumho Ecsta ASX's, they sucked, right now has General Altimax Arctic's on Enkei 17's for winter, getting new tires for the 18's this spring), and a K&N filter. Dead-nuts stock otherwise, and that's fine with him. Pics: And finally, for my last act.... The two together!!! Hope this wasn't too long, LOL.   8. Thanks guys! I really do like both cars, but the SSEi definitely has more get up and go, especially from a dead-stop. The next round of mods is going to make it no-contest. Current mods: Intense-Racing Fenderwell Intake (filter is inside the bumper) Smoothflow Machining Hub and 3.6" supercharger pulley (modular setup) 180* Thermostat 3" Exhaust Downpipe & 3" magnaflow cat Cleared headlights Tinted Tails GXP Carbon Fiber Interior pieces (except rear vents in console) Aux-In via XM wiring (retains XM) Yokohama Avid ENVigor tires Next Round (hopefully): Ported & Polished Eaton GenIII M90 S/C housing Ported intake manifold, Exhaust manifold and heads 1.9 ratio roller rockers & 90# springs 3.4 pulley on S/C Minor other cosmetic mods under the hood BTW: I forgot to mention, the SSEi is bound to crack 180,000 miles soon, and the GXP is right around 90k. Bought them with 139k in Oct. 08 and 46k in May 09, respectively.
